Hi can sp2 throttle body will fit into SP1 turnone airbox ?

SubSailor
06-27-2011, 03:45 PM
The SP2 throttle bodies will fit with a T-O SP1 airbox.
You'll also need the mount rubbers for the throttle bodies to mount.
Plus the SP2 ECU.

However, the T-O SP1 airbox itself will not fit in an SP2 frame due to the added gussets near the steering head.
The T-O SP2 airbox will fit both models.

That's why I was a bit guarded with my previous answer.

In theory the SP1 ECU use should be ok, since the Power Commander alters injector timing and should compensate for any differences between flow rates (if any) between the SP1 and SP2 injectors.

The fuel pressure is the same, so it may be possible there is no flow rate difference at all, just better atomization with the SP2 injectors.

All I can say is, give a try and see.
Just let us know what you find, for future reference.

mondo
06-30-2011, 01:28 PM
I adapted SP2 injectors to fit into my SP1 without the SP2 ECU but using a power commander.It need a remap, but in the end there was no real power difference, it did seam to have smoother throttle responce, but I ended up switching back to SP1 injectors, just to keep it a SP1:)
